AWS Encryption SDK
APACHE-2.0 License
Bot releases are hidden (Show)
Published by ShubhamChaturvedi7 5 months ago
The AWS Encryption SDK for Python no longer supports Python 3.7
as of version 3.3; only Python 3.8+ is supported.
Published by rishav-karanjit 7 months ago
Published by imabhichow about 2 years ago
The AWS Encryption SDK for Python Major Version 2 is End of Support.
It will no longer receive security updates or bug fixes.
Consider updating to the latest version of the AWS Encryption SDK for Python.
cryptography
range to greater than or equal to 2.5.0 less than 37Published by justplaz about 2 years ago
The AWS Encryption SDK for Python Major Version 1 is End of Support.
It will no longer receive security updates or bug fixes.
Consider updating to the latest version of the AWS Encryption SDK for Python.
Published by josecorella over 2 years ago
cryptography
to last version that supports Python2Published by josecorella over 2 years ago
cryptography
to last version that supports Python2Published by josecorella over 2 years ago
Published by texastony almost 3 years ago
The AWS Encryption SDK for Python no longer supports Python 3.5
as of version 3.1; only Python 3.6+ is supported. Customers using
Python 3.5 can still use the 2.x line of the AWS Encryption SDK for Python,
which will continue to receive security updates, in accordance
with our Support Policy.
Published by farleyb-amazon over 3 years ago
The AWS Encryption SDK for Python no longer supports Python 2 or Python 3.4
as of major version 3.x; only Python 3.5+ is supported. Customers using Python 2
or Python 3.4 can still use the 2.x line of the AWS Encryption SDK for Python,
which will continue to receive security updates for the next 12 months, in accordance
with our Support Policy.
int_from_bytes
#355.Published by farleyb-amazon over 3 years ago
The AWS Encryption SDK for Python is discontinuing support for Python 2. Future major versions of this library will drop support for Python 2 and begin to adopt changes that are known to break Python 2.
Support for Python 3.4 will be removed at the same time. Moving forward, we will support Python 3.5+.
Security updates will still be available for the Encryption SDK 2.x line for the next 12 months, in accordance with our Support Policy.
Published by seebees over 3 years ago
AWS KMS multi-Region Key support (#350)
Added new the master key MRKAwareKMSMasterKey
and the new master key providers MRKAwareStrictAwsKmsMasterKeyProvider
and MRKAwareDiscoveryAwsKmsMasterKeyProvider
that support AWS KMS multi-Region Keys.
See https://docs.aws.amazon.com/kms/latest/developerguide/multi-region-keys-overview.html
for more details about AWS KMS multi-Region Keys.
See https://docs.aws.amazon.com/encryption-sdk/latest/developer-guide/configure.html#config-mrks
for more details about how the AWS Encryption SDK interoperates
with AWS KMS multi-Region keys.
Published by farleyb-amazon over 3 years ago
Published by farleyb-amazon over 3 years ago
Published by farleyb-amazon over 3 years ago
Published by farleyb-amazon about 4 years ago
See migration guide for more details: https://docs.aws.amazon.com/encryption-sdk/latest/developer-guide/migration.html
Published by farleyb-amazon about 4 years ago
aws_encryption_sdk
modulePublished by farleyb-amazon about 4 years ago
KMSMasterKeyProvider
is deprecated. Customers should move to StrictAwsKmsMasterKeyProvider
with explicit key ids, or DiscoveryAwsKmsMasterKeyProvider
to allow decryption of any ciphertext to which the application has access.encrypt
, decrypt
, and stream
methods in the aws_encryption_sdk
module are deprecated. Customers should move to the identically named methods on the new EncryptionSDKClient
class.See migration guide: https://docs.aws.amazon.com/encryption-sdk/latest/developer-guide/migration.html
Published by mattsb42-aws over 5 years ago
source_stream
APIs except for read()
. #103source_stream
when they themselves close.StreamDecryptor
StreamEncryptor
to close your source_stream
for you,StreamDecryptor.body_start
and StreamDecryptor.body_end
,unittest
tests to pytest
. #99MasterKeyprovider.decrypt_data_key_from_list
error handling. #150Published by mattsb42-aws almost 6 years ago
KMSMasterKeyProvider
client cache if they fail to connect to endpoint. #86streaming_client
classes to properly interpret short reads in source streams. #24